Remember that the home buyer tax credit is not just for new home buyers. If you’re moving, and have lived in your current home at least five of the last eight years, you may also qualify for a tax credit up to $6,500. The deadline to be under contract to purchase is April 30th 2010, and you have to close the sale by June 30th 2010.

Boulder Sold Single Family Homes January 2010 :
Number Sold: 27
Average Sales Price: $818,481
Median Sales Price: $505,000
Average Days On Market: 136
Boulder Sold Condos January 2010 :
Number Sold: 19
Average Price: $385,049
Median Price: $319,500
Average Days On Market: 295
Whoa, the average days on market for sold condos shot up tremendously compared to December 2009. It looks like maybe some condos that had been sitting on the market for a very long time finally sold. Just a guess, but that would explain the big change in the data.
